## Vendor Note: Spokewise Rebalancing Tool

For the release manager: Spokewise is supplied by Corvid Mobility Labs under a quarterly update contract. Do not ship their builds without running the depot simulation suite first; two past releases regressed truck routing. Patch windows are negotiated per release. For scheduling updates or reporting defects, contact their integration desk here.

escalation mailbox, hahag-yagaf: ralir@paliqhq.test

Ticket TELEM-442: signature check failing on compressed telemetry payloads. After we switched Skylark's telemetry uploader to zstd, the collector rejects every batch with "digest mismatch." Looks like we're signing the uncompressed bytes but verifying the compressed ones — classic. Flagging for security review since the fix touches the verification path. Repro steps are in the attached script; run it against staging. To reproduce the verifier side locally you'll need the signing key, pasted just below.

rollout seal: bky4_yke3

## Break-Glass Access — Cron Drift Investigation

New contractors: break-glass applies only while investigating the Tindermill cron drift. Request approval in the ops channel, open a ticket first, then use the emergency console on the Harrowfen bastion. All sessions are recorded; access auto-expires in four hours. Touch only scheduler nodes. When the bastion prompts during login, supply the recovery passphrase below.

strongbox words: aldax-istox-sorion-isteth-gilion-tamius-norok-aldax-fraox-wenius